Blondie - Dreaming Live Performance on The Midnight Special

Venue: The Midnight Special Location: Los Angeles, CA, United States Date: October 5, 1979

On October 5, 1979, Blondie performed "Dreaming" on *The Midnight Special*, a pivotal point in their career that showcased their rising fame in the late 1970s. At this time, the band had just released their critically acclaimed album, *Parallel Lines*, earlier in 1978, which propelled them into mainstream success with hits like "Heart of Glass" and "One Way or Another." This period was marked by Blondie’s innovative blend of punk, disco, and pop, which was becoming widely influential. Notably, *Parallel Lines* has been recognized as one of the defining albums of the era, contributing significantly to the band's reputation. By the time of this live recording, they had also started to solidify their unique style, which included a strong visual aesthetic complemented by Debbie Harry's charismatic stage presence. The performance exemplifies the band's energetic style and their ability to captivate audiences during their peak.
